Mental Benefits of Kickboxing

  • Stress Relief: Kickboxing helps release endorphins, the body’s natural “feel-good” chemicals, while simultaneously lowering cortisol (a primary stress hormone). Striking pads or bags allows for a healthy release of frustration and pent-up tension, making you feel calmer and more relaxed after workouts.

  • Mood Enhancement: The combination of intense physical activity and skill development boosts mood and helps alleviate symptoms of depression and anxiety by improving overall well-being.

  • Cognitive Function: Engaging in kickboxing requires mental focus, learning new techniques, and quick problem-solving. Research shows that kickboxing training can enhance attention, memory, and processing speed, further promoting overall brain health.

  • Confidence and Self-Esteem: Mastery of new skills, improved physical fitness, and the sense of accomplishment gained from training build confidence and positive self-image.

  • Burnout Reduction and Resilience: The challenges and routines of training help develop resilience and a growth mindset—belief in your ability to improve through hard work—which have lasting mental health benefits.

Physical Benefits of Kickboxing

  • Full-Body Strength: Every session involves punches, kicks, knees, and defensive moves that activate upper body, lower body, and core muscles simultaneously. This improves muscular function, stability, and power.

  • Cardiovascular Fitness: Kickboxing is both aerobic and anaerobic, significantly boosting heart health, endurance, and lung capacity. It seamlessly blends steady-state activity with bursts of high intensity, making it one of the most versatile cardio workouts.

  • Weight Loss and Fat Loss: High-intensity sequences trigger fat burning (even after your session due to the afterburn effect) while building lean, functional muscle that sculpts a well-defined, athletic body.

  • Agility, Balance, and Coordination: Frequent changes in direction, rapid footwork, and varied striking angles improve balance, coordination, speed, and reflexes. This reduces the risk of falls and injuries as you age.

  • Flexibility: Dynamic kicking, stretching, and varied full-range movements enhance overall flexibility, reducing muscle tightness and promoting joint health.

  • Better Sleep: Regular, intense physical activity improves sleep quality and duration, supporting overall wellness.

  • 1st Grade (Counter Punches / Leg Behind Kicks)

    Basic Techniques:

    1. Slide Forward / Slide Back

    2. Move Left / Move Right

    3. Change Legs

    4. Turn

    Combinations:

    1. Counter Front Punch, Reverse Punch, Front Punch

    2. Front Kick, Leg Behind, Front Punch, Reverse Punch, Front Punch

    3. Roundhouse Kick, Leg Behind, Front Punch, Reverse Punch, Front Punch

    Combination Pad Work:

    1. Combination Pad Work 1-2-3

    Self-Defence:

    1. Cover, Cover, Duck, Duck, Lean Back (Head Covers)

  • 2nd Grade (Slide In Punches / Counter & Skip In Kicks)

    Basic Techniques:

    1. Slide in Front Punch, Slide Back

    2.  Slide in Front Punch,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    3. Step in Front Punch, Slide Back

    Combinations:

    1. Counter Front Kick, Leg In Front, Front Punch, Reverse Punch, Front Punch

    2. Counter Roundhouse Kick, Leg in Front, Front Punch, Reverse Punch, Front Punch

    3. Skip in Front Kick, Skip Back, Front Punch, Reverse Punch, Front Punch

    Combination Pad Work:

    1. Combination Pad Work 1-2-3

    Self-Defence:

    1. Cover, Cover, Duck, Duck, Lean Back

    2. Outer Covers

  • 3rd Grade (Side Kick)

    Basic Techniques:

    1. Side Kick, Leg Behind, Front Punch, Reverse Punch, Front Punch

    2. Double Roundhouse Kick, Leg Behind. (Knee / Body)

    3. Skip in Double Roundhouse Kick, Skip Back. (Knee / Body)

    Combinations:

    1. Front Kick, Leg in Front,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    2. Skip in Front Kick, Leg in Front,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    3. Roundhouse Kick, leg in Front,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    Combination Pad Work:

    1. Combination Pad Work 1-2-3

    Self-Defence:

    1. Cover, Cover, Duck, Duck

    2. Outer Covers

    3. Inner Covers

  • 4th Grade (Double Kicks)

    Basic Techniques

    1. Double Side Kick, Leg Behind

    2. Front kick, Leg Behind, Counter Roundhouse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ch

    3. Front Punch, Reverse Punch, Roundhouse Kick, Leg Behind

    Combinations: (Leg In Front)

    1. Skip in Double Side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    2. Front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    3. Front Punch, Reverse Punch, Roundhouse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    Combination Pad Work

    1. Combination Pad Work 1-2-3

    Self-Defence

    1. Cover, Cover, Duck, Duck

    2. Outer Covers

    3. Inner Covers

    4. Leg Covers

  • 5TH GRADE (Backfist)

    Basic Techniques

    1. Counter Back Fist

    2. Counter Back Fist, Reverse Punch, Front Punch

    3. Slide in Back Fist, Slide Back

    Combinations (Leg In Front)

    1. Counter Back fist, Skip in Roundhouse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    2. Front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Leg in Front,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    3. Front Punch, Reverse Punch, Roundhouse Kick, Reverse Punch, Roundhouse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    Combination Pad Work

    1. Glove on Glove x 1 Min

    2. Combination Pad Work 1-2-3

    Self-Defence

    1. All Previous Techniques

    2. Cover, Cover, Slip, Slip (Mixed With Straight and Hook Punches)

  • 6TH GRADE (Slip Punch)

    Basic Techniques

    1. Counter Slip Punch

    2. Counter Slip Punch, Reverse Punch, Front Punch

    3. Slide in Slip Punch

    Combinations (Leg In Front)

    1. Front Kick, Leg in Front, Slip Punch,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    2. Front Punch, Skip In Side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    3. Front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Side Kick, Leg in Front,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    Combination Pad Work

    1. Glove on Glove x 1 Min

    2. Combination Pad Work 1-2-3

    Self-Defence

    1. Palm Strike

  • 7TH GRADE (Hook Kicks)

    Basic Techniques

    1. Hook Kick, Leg Behind, Front Punch, Reverse Punch, Front Punch

    2. Skip In Hook Kick, Skip Back, Front Punch, Reverse Punch, Front Punch

    3. Hook Kick, Leg in Front,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    Combinations (Leg In Front)

    1. Roundhouse Kick, Side Kick, Hook Kick, Leg In Front,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    2. Skip Side Kick, Hook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Leg In Front,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    3. Skip Hook Kick, Double Roundhouse Kick, Leg in Front,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    Combination Pad Work

    1. Glove on Glove 2 x 1 Min

    2. Combination Pad Work 1-2-3

    Self-Defence

    1. All Previous Techniques

    2. Elbow Strike

  • 8TH GRADE (Spin Side Kick)

    Basic Techniques

    1. Spin Side Kick, Leg in Front,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    2. Front Punch, Spinning Back Fist,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    3. Switch Punch,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    Combinations (Leg In Front)

    1. Front Punch, Reverse Punch, Roundhouse Kick, Spin Side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    2. Front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Spin Side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    3. Switch Punch, Reverse Punch, Roundhouse Kick, Spin Side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    Combination Pad Work

    1. Form Fighting 2 x 1 Min

    2. Combination Pad Work 1-2-3

    Self-Defence

    1. All Previous Techniques

    2. Knee Strike

  • 9TH GRADE (Spinning Hook Kick)

    Basic Techniques

    1. Spinning Kick, Leg In Front, Reverse Punch Front Punch, Slide Back

    2. Roundhouse Kick, Spinning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    3. Reverse Punch, Stop, Step in Slip Punch

    Combinations (Leg in front)

    1. Front Punch, Reverse Punch, Roundhouse Kick, Spinning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    2. Front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Side Kick, Leg in Front, Spinning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    3. Skip Double Side Kick, Spin Double Side Kick, Reverse Punch Front Punch, Slide Back

    Combination Pad Work

    1. Form Fighting x 1 Min

    2. Synch. Form Fighting x 1 Min

    3. Free Padding x 2 Min

    4. Combination Pad Work 1-2-3

    Self-Defence

    1. Face Technique 1

    2. All Previous Techniques

    3. Combination Knee/palm/elbow strike

  • 10TH GRADE (Back Kick)

    Basic Techniques

    1. Back Kick, Leg in Front,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    2. Back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Leg In Front,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    3. Back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Leg in Front,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    Combinations (Leg In Front)

    1. Front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Back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Leg in Front,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    2. Jumping Front Kick, Back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Spinning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    3. Front Punch, Spinning Back Fist, Reverse Punch, Roundhouse Kick, Back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    Combination Pad Work

    1. Form Fighting 2 x 1 Min

    2. Synch. Form Fighting 2 x 1 Min

    3. Free Padding 2 x 1 Min

    4. Combination Pad Work 1-2-3

    Self-Defence

    1. Face Techniques 1-2

    2. All Previous Techniques

    3. Combination Shin kick/elbow/palm/knee

  • 11TH GRADE (Step In Spinning Kick)

    Basic Techniques

    1. Roundhouse Kick, Step in Spinning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    2. Roundhouse Kick, Spinning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    3. Counter Hook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Spinning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    Combinations (Leg In Front)

    1. Roundhouse Kick, Side Kick, Hook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Back Kick, Step in Spinning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    2. Front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Side Kick, Step In Spinning Kick, Double Roundhouse Kick

    3. Skip Side Kick, Spinning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Spinning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    Combination Pad Work

    1. Form Fighting 2 x 2 Min

    2. Synch. Form Fighting 2 x 2 Min

    3. Free Padding 2 x 2 Min

    4. Combination Pad Work 1-2-3

    Self-Defence

    1. Face Techniques 1-2

    2. Front Kicks 1

    3. All Previous Techniques

  • BLACK BELT (Axe Kick / Crescent Kick)

    Basic Techniques

    1. Counter Hook Kick, Axe Kick, Spin Side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    2. Front Kick, Outer Crescent kick, Axe Kick, Spinning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    3. Axe Kick, Side Kick, Spinning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    Combinations (Leg In Front)

    1. Front Punch, Reverse Punch, Step In Spinning Kick, Roundhouse Kick, Back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    2. Front Punch, Reverse Punch, Jump Front Kick, Back Kick, Spinning Kick, Step In Jumping Spinning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    3. Counter Hook Kick, Axe Kick, Jump Spin Crescent Kick, Spinning Kick, Reverse Punch, Front Punch, Slide Back

    Combination Pad Work

    1. As Per Instructor

    2. Combination Pad Work 1-2-3

    Self-Defence

    1. Face Techniques 1-2

    2. Front Kicks 1 – 2

    3. All Previous Techniques

Kickboxing Movement Patterns

Kickboxing movement patterns are unique compared to standard workout routines and incorporate:

  • Punches: Jab, cross, hook, uppercut—each requires body rotation and weight transfer.

  • Kicks: Front kick, roundhouse, side kick, back kick—demanding hip and core rotation, as well as balance.

  • Defensive Movements: Slips, ducks, blocks, and footwork such as pivoting, shuffling, and bouncing to evade and counter attacks.

  • Core Engagement: Every strike and movement originates from the core, promoting rotational power and functional strength.

  • Multi-joint Exercises: Movements such as squats and lunges are integrated to reinforce the lower body while building functional fitness.

  • Interval Structure: Training can alternate between high-intensity bursts and active recovery, making it adaptable to various fitness levels and goals.
